Articles & Tutorials

Explore Our Latest Articles and Tutorials

Insights, updates, and strategies for building scalable law firms.

Developer coding in a calm, modern workspace with clean code on screen

Vibe Coding: Crafting Software That Feels Right

April 19, 20262 min read

Coding, Creativity

What Is Vibe Coding? Writing Software That Actually Feels Good

Vibe coding is the emerging idea that great software isn’t just correct and fast—it also feels right to build and to use. It blends clean engineering with intuition, mood, and flow, so the process of coding is as satisfying as the final product.

Custom HTML/CSS/JAVASCRIPT

The Core Principles of Vibe Coding

At its heart, vibe coding is about experience. Instead of obsessing only over features, you pay attention to:

  • How it feels to read and extend the code in six months

  • Whether the tools, naming, and structure keep you in a state of flow

  • If the final product feels effortless for users, not just functional

💡 Pro Tip: When something feels clunky to build, that’s often a signal the underlying design wants to be simplified, not just refactored.

Vibe coding doesn’t mean avoiding hard problems or polishing endlessly. It means using clarity, consistency, and empathy as design constraints, right alongside performance and security. The “vibe” becomes a practical compass: if a function, API, or UI feels confusing, you treat that as real technical debt—not a cosmetic detail.

Close-up of organized, readable code on a laptop in a professional setting

Thoughtful structure and naming give your future self a better coding vibe.

Bringing Vibe Into Your Everyday Coding

You can start small: choose consistent patterns, write human-readable comments, and design interfaces that reduce friction rather than add clever tricks. Over time, this mindset turns routine tasks into a creative practice—where every commit contributes not only to functionality, but to an overall vibe of clarity, calm, and confidence.

In practice, that might look like:

  • Refactoring noisy functions into small, well-named helpers so the main flow reads like a story.

  • Adding tiny affordances—like smart defaults, gentle error messages, and keyboard shortcuts—that make your app feel considerate.

  • Protecting your focus with a simple ritual: a short design note before coding, and a brief reflection after each session on what felt smooth or rough.

“If the codebase feels good to work in, great products become a side effect.”

📌 Key Takeaway: Vibe coding isn’t fluff—it’s a practical way to design systems that are easier to maintain, more fun to evolve, and kinder to both developers and users.

vibe codingsoftware developmentintuitive codingcreative codingcoding flowsoftware design
blog author image

Sadia Anwer

Sadia keeps the engine running smooth. Calm, sharp, and dependable, she handles systems, support, and automation with ease—making sure every detail is handled so nothing slips through the cracks.

Back to Blog
Blog Image

How I Use AI to Turn Discovery Calls into Proposals in 5 Min

Published on: 25/07/2025

Latest Articles

Schedule Meeting

INTRODUCING

10-Step AI & Automation Playbook

A proven blueprint designed to suit any type of firm. We handle the tech, automation, content, and operations. You focus on leadership, service, and scale.

Here's what we build with you:

  • A brand that actually attracts leads

  • Sales funnels and automated onboarding

  • Content that drives authority

  • AI tools that handle follow-up, FAQs, contracts, and more

  • A system that can run—even when you’re on vacation

You’ve Proven You Can Hustle.

Stop grinding harder. Build smarter systems that create clarity, freedom, and scale. We help founders plug AI into their workflows and grow with confidence.

Ready to let go and grow?

© 2026 Insert Fuel | Terms of Use | Privacy Policy

Powered by: